5-ingredient cookies

We tried these out a few days ago, and they were really good!

1 can sweetened condensed milk
3/4 c. peanut butter
1 3/4 c. baking mix (Bisquick)
1 t. vanilla
1/2 bag chocolate chips (mini chocolate chips would work best)

Mix the sweetened condensed milk and peanut butter together.  Add baking mix, vanilla, and chocolate chips.  Roll dough into small balls or use small cookie scoop.  Put on cookie sheet.  Ues a fork to flatten them a bit and give them that distinctive peanut butter cookie pattern.  Bake at 375 degrees for 6-8 minutes.  Don't overbake them and they will stay soft.
